Salles-sur-Mer — Score 39/100.

Why this score? This score is penalized mainly by a high purchase price for the area (16/100) and a weak rental yield (24/100).

❓ Frequently asked questions about Salles-sur-Mer

What is the price per m² in Salles-sur-Mer?

The median price per m² in Salles-sur-Mer is 5 444 €.

What is the rental yield in Salles-sur-Mer?

The gross rental yield in Salles-sur-Mer is 3.0%.

Is Salles-sur-Mer a good real estate investment?

Salles-sur-Mer has a ScorCity score of 39/100, making it a risky investment.

What is the average energy rating in Salles-sur-Mer?

The most common energy rating class in Salles-sur-Mer is D.
